Meaning of sobriquet
A sobriquet is a nickname or a descriptive name given to someone, often based on a characteristic or achievement.
Etymology of sobriquet
The word "sobriquet" originates from the Old French word "sobriquet," which is derived from the word "sobrique," meaning "a chuck under the chin," and the suffix "-et," which is a diminutive form
Historically, the term "sobriquet" was used to describe a nickname or a descriptive name given to someone, often based on a physical characteristic, personality trait, or achievement
